Description
Overview: Darwill is a nationally recognized print and marketing communications firm based in the west suburbs of Chicago. As a premier provider of complex marketing products, including direct mail, employee communications and marketing collateral, we influence excellent results for CMO’s, Directors of Marketing and Print Production Professionals by providing ideas, workflow solutions, cutting edge production technologies and a seamless execution process. Our diverse product offering includes data acquisition, email appends, integrated marketing services, production workflows, custom print production, direct mail solutions, fulfillment and complete lettershop, bindery and mailing services.
Location: Oakbrook, IL
Reports to: Director of Customer Experience
Responsibilities/Essential Functions:
- Transition of orders from the sales team and placement of orders into the ordering system.
- Acts as the day to day client contact, focused on execution and project management and maintain timely delivery of marketing efforts.
- Execution of monthly workflow, data files, client mail plans.
- Manage the delivery of weekly and monthly call tracking and reporting back to sales team and customers. (Reports, Analytics, Project Documents, data, Direct Mail and related components, etc.)
- Consistently monitors, accurately identifies and assesses scope changes and the impact to the production schedule and budget of a project then communicates with inter-departmental team project status.
- Strong attention to detail, problem solving abilities and strategic thinking.
- Prepares final billing by gathering information from internal functions.
- Ability to work independently in a team environment
Qualifications:
- Minimum of an Associate’s Degree
- 2-5 years of Direct Mail experience
- Proficient in Microsoft Office, Excel and Outlook specifically
- Detail Oriented
- Excellent organizational skills, ability to multi-task
- Positive Attitude
Work Environment/Physical Demands:
- This job requires you to sit in a cubicle or office, on a computer (1 or more monitors) for the majority of the day.
- May be required to work extended/evening hours as needed.
